How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Brendonwood?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Brendonwood Studio Apartments | $863 | $725 | $1,181 |
Brendonw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,115 | $411 | $2,390 |
Brendonw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,294 | $750 | $2,055 |
Brendonw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,617 | $1,345 | $1,865 |
Brendonwood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,625 | $1,480 | $2,000 |

Getting Around the Brendonwood Neighborhood in Indianapolis, IN
Walk Score®
19 / 100
Car-Dependent
Almost all errands require a car
Bike Score®
34 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
6 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
